The Boston Red Sox have completed a two-year, $12 million deal with Bobby Jenks and the albino squirrel which resides on his chin.
Have no fear, Beantown Faithful. Jonathan Papelbon will remain the team's closer in 2011.
Jenks, a two-time All-Star with the Chicago White Sox, saved 27 games last season before losing his closing job due to forearm problems at the beginning of September.
